Example #1
0
        public async void GetLibroById()
        {
            var mockContexto = CrearContexto();
            var mapper       = CrearMapper();

            var request = new ConsultaFiltro.LibroUnico();

            request.LibroId = Guid.Empty;

            var manejador = new ConsultaFiltro.Manejador(mockContexto.Object, mapper);

            var libro = await manejador.Handle(request, new System.Threading.CancellationToken());

            Assert.NotNull(libro);
            Assert.True(libro.LibreriaMaterialId == request.LibroId);
        }
Example #2
0
        public async void GetLibroPorId()
        {
            var mockContexto = CrearContexto();
            var mapConfig    = new MapperConfiguration(cfg => {
                cfg.AddProfile(new MappingTest());
            });
            var mapper = mapConfig.CreateMapper();

            var request = new ConsultaFiltro.LibroUnico();

            request.LibroId = Guid.Empty;

            var manejador = new ConsultaFiltro.Manejador(mockContexto.Object, mapper);
            var libro     = await manejador.Handle(request, new System.Threading.CancellationToken());

            Assert.NotNull(libro);
            Assert.True(libro.LibreriaMaterialId == Guid.Empty);
        }
Example #3
0
        public async void GetLibroById()
        {
            Mock <ContextoLibreria> mockContexto = CrearContext();
            MapperConfiguration     mapConfig    = new MapperConfiguration(cfg =>
            {
                cfg.AddProfile(new MappingTest());
            });

            IMapper mapper = mapConfig.CreateMapper();

            ConsultaFiltro.Manejador  manejador = new ConsultaFiltro.Manejador(mockContexto.Object, mapper);
            ConsultaFiltro.LibroUnico request   = new ConsultaFiltro.LibroUnico()
            {
                LibroGuid = Guid.Empty
            };

            LibroMaterialDto result = await manejador.Handle(request, new System.Threading.CancellationToken());

            Assert.NotNull(result);
            Assert.True(result.LibreriaMaterialId == Guid.Empty);
        }